Air Supply

Making use of their heavily orchestrated, sweet ballads, the Australian soft rock and roll group Air Supply became a staple of early-’80s radio, scoring a string of seven straight Top Five singles. Atmosphere Supply, for some intents and reasons, was the duo of vocalists Russell Hitchcock and Graham Russell; additional members arrived through the group over time, yet they just functioned as support music artists and added small towards the group’s audio. Hitchcock and Russell fulfilled while performing inside a Sydney, Australia, creation of Jesus Christ Superstar in 1976. Both singers shaped a collaboration and with the help of four supporting music artists — keyboardist Frank Esler-Smith, guitarist David Moyse, bassist David Green, and drummer Ralph Cooper — Atmosphere Supply was created. For quite some time, the group obtained no attention beyond Australia, earning one significant strike single, “Like along with other Bruises.” Their 1st international exposure arrived in the past due ’70s, when Pole Stewart got them as his starting work on a UNITED STATES tour. Air Source signed an archive agreement with Arista in 1980, launching their first record by the finish of the entire year. Shed in Like, their debut, was a significant success within the U.S., offering over two million copies and spawning the strike singles “Shed in Like,” “All Out of Like,” and “Every Girl on earth.” The next yr they released their second recording, ONE THAT YOU LIKE. The title monitor became their just number one strike looked after featured two additional Top Ten strikes, “Right here I Am (Simply AFTER I Thought I HAD BEEN Over You)” and “Lovely Dreams.” Making use of their third recording, 1982’s Right now and Forever, their recognition dipped somewhat — it just had one TOP hit, “Actually the Evenings Are Better,” as well as the additional two singles, “Youthful Like” and “Two Much less Lonely People on the planet,” scraped underneath of the very best 40. Air Source released a Greatest Hits collection in 1983, having a fresh single, “HAVING INTERCOURSE Out of Almost nothing.” The solitary spent fourteen days at number 2 while the recording peaked at quantity seven and finally offered over four million copies. 2 yrs later on, they released Atmosphere Supply, their 4th recording. It featured the quantity 19 solitary “JUST LIKE I Am,” nonetheless it was very clear that their viewers was shrinking — the recording was their 1st not to proceed platinum. Hearts in Movement (1986) was actually less effective, peaking at quantity 84 and spending just nine weeks within the charts. Following its unsatisfactory performance, Air Source split up. Hitchcock and Russell reunited in 1991, liberating Earth Is…, however the recording didn’t make the graphs as do 1993’s Vanishing Competition and 1995’s Information From Nowhere. The brand new millennium designated the band’s 1st studio recording in four years, along with a summer season tour to get Yours Truly.
